Atlas Air Worldwide Announces Leadership Transition Plan
July 02 2019 - 9:00AM
Atlas Air Worldwide Holdings, Inc. (Nasdaq: AAWW) today announced
that President and Chief Executive Officer William J. (Bill) Flynn
will retire from the company effective January 1, 2020, after a
successful 13-year tenure, and become Chairman of the Board on that
date.
The board has appointed John W. Dietrich,
current Executive Vice President and Chief Operating Officer, as
Mr. Flynn’s successor. Mr. Dietrich will become President and Chief
Operating Officer effective immediately, and he will retain the
role as President when he assumes the role of Chief Executive
Officer on January 1, 2020.
Additionally, Robert F. Agnew, current Chairman
of the Board, will become the Board’s Lead Independent Director,
effective January 1, 2020.
The transitions and appointments are the
culmination of a comprehensive succession process led by the board
to ensure strong leadership continuity as the company continues to
advance its strategic growth agenda. Continuing to serve on the
Senior Leadership Team are Michael Steen, Executive Vice President
and Chief Commercial Officer, and President and Chief Executive
Officer of Titan Aviation Holdings, Inc.; Spencer Schwartz,
Executive Vice President and Chief Financial Officer; Adam Kokas,
Executive Vice President, General Counsel and Secretary; and
Patricia Goodwin-Peters, Senior Vice President, Human
Resources.

During Mr. Flynn’s tenure, the company has
become the leading provider of outsourced aviation
services. Key significant achievements include the
transformation of Polar Air Cargo with the DHL joint venture;
investment in the 747-8F platform; acquisition of Southern Air,
which added 777 and 737 operating capabilities to the suite of
services; growth in relationships with express and e-commerce
customers; expansions with long-term customers; and entry into
passenger charter flying. Additionally, the company launched
and expanded its dry-leasing subsidiary, Titan, to become one of
the leading freighter-centric leasing companies with potential for
further growth.

Mr. Dietrich has over 30 years of experience in
the aviation and air cargo industries, including more than 20 with
Atlas Air Worldwide. He has served in his current COO role since
2006, and is responsible for all aspects of the company’s global
operations. Mr. Dietrich joined the company in 1999 as Associate
General Counsel and was promoted to Senior Vice President, General
Counsel and Corporate Secretary in 2004, which included
responsibility for human resources and corporate communications.
Prior to joining Atlas Air Worldwide, Mr. Dietrich worked for
United Airlines for 13 years, serving as a corporate attorney in
his last position there.

About Atlas Air
Worldwide:
Atlas Air Worldwide is a leading global provider
of outsourced aircraft and aviation operating services. It is the
parent company of Atlas Air, Inc., Southern Air Holdings, Inc. and
Titan Aviation Holdings, Inc., and is the majority shareholder of
Polar Air Cargo Worldwide, Inc. Our companies operate the world’s
largest fleet of 747 freighter aircraft and provide customers the
broadest array of Boeing 747, 777, 767, 757 and 737 aircraft for
domestic, regional and international cargo and passenger
operations.
